Water remediation services involve identifying and removing excess moisture or water from a property to prevent further damage and health issues. These services typically include thorough water extraction, drying, and dehumidification of affected areas. Professionals use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ture behind walls, beneath flooring, or within insulation, ensuring that all sources of water are addressed. Proper water remediation helps protect the structural integrity of a property and reduces the risk of mold growth, which can develop quickly in damp environments.
Many water-related problems can be effectively managed through remediation services. Common issues include flooding caused by heavy storms, burst pipes, or appliance leaks. Water intrusion can lead to warped flooring, stained walls, and compromised building materials if not properly handled. Additionally, lingering moisture can create an environment conducive to mold and mildew, which pose health concerns for residents. Timely remediation is essential to minimize property damage and avoid costly rep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Water Remediation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Noblesville,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ine water remediation jobs in Noblesville typically range from $250 to $600. These projects often involve addressing localized leaks or minor water damage in a single room or small area. Most local contractors handle these within the lower to mid-price range.
Moderate Projects - Medium-sized remediation efforts, such as larger affected areas or partial water extraction, generally cost between $600 and $2,000. These projects are common and may include drying out multiple rooms or addressing moderate flooding issues.
Extensive Remediation - Larger, more complex water damage repairs, including structural drying and extensive mold mitigation, can range from $2,000 to $5,000. Fewer projects reach into this tier, often involving significant water intrusion or damage to multiple building components.
Full Replacement and Major Repairs - Complete water damage restoration or replacement of major building elements can exceed $5,000, with costs varying widely based on scope.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ve extensive structural work or long-term remediation efforts in Noblesville and nearby are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of water issues can water remediation services address? Water remediation services can handle problems like flooding, water damage from leaks, sewage backups, and mold growth caused by excess moisture.
How do local contractors typically perform water remediation? They assess the affected area, remove standing water, dry and dehumidify the space, and clean or disinfect surfaces to prevent mold and further damage.
Is water remediation necessary after a minor leak? Even small leaks can lead to hidden moisture and mold growth; a professional assessment can determine if remediation is needed to prevent future issues.
What should be considered when choosing a water remediation service provider? It's important to select experienced local contractors with good reputation who can evaluate the extent of water damage and recommend appropriate remediation steps.
Can water remediation services help prevent mold growth? Yes, by thoroughly drying and disinfecting affected areas, local service providers can reduce the risk of mold developing after water damage.
